Understanding the Core Gameplay Mechanics

At its heart, the game is a study in timing and risk assessment. Players guide the chicken, attempting to cross a busy roadway without collision. Vehicles of varying speeds and types traverse the screen, creating a dynamic and unpredictable environment. The longer the chicken survives, the more challenging the game becomes, with vehicles appearing faster and in greater numbers. A crucial element of gameplay involves collecting power-ups scattered along the road. These power-ups provide temporary advantages, such as increased speed, invincibility, or magnet-like attraction to bonuses. Strategic use of these power-ups is often the key to achieving high scores and reaching greater distances.

Strategic Power-Up Usage

Different power-ups cater to distinct playstyles and situations. Invincibility provides a temporary shield, allowing the chicken to safely navigate even the densest traffic. Speed boosts are ideal for quickly crossing long stretches, but require careful control to avoid overshooting. Magnetic bonuses attract coins and other rewards, accelerating progress. Mastering the timing of power-up activation is essential. Using a speed boost just before a clear lane appears can dramatically increase distance covered. Activating invincibility when surrounded by vehicles can prevent a costly crash. The skillful integration of power-ups adds depth to the seemingly simple gameplay loop. Learning which power-up to prioritize in different scenarios creates a rewarding learning curve for players.

Power-Up Effect Optimal Use
Speed Boost Increases Chicken's Movement Speed Crossing long gaps, outpacing slower vehicles
Invincibility Provides temporary immunity to collisions Navigating heavy traffic, risky crossings
Magnet Attracts nearby coins and bonuses Collecting a large number of rewards quickly
Double Points Doubles the points earned for a short duration During periods of successful crossings, maximizing score

The table above highlights the key power-ups and their strategic applications. Utilizing these effectively is paramount to becoming a proficient player.
